Inaugural Big 5 Construction Impact Awards Salute Region’s Project Leaders

The organiser of The Big 5, dmg events, today unveiled its shortlist for the inaugural Big 5 Construction Impact Awards, the awards ceremony for which will take place on 12th September, 2021, at Dubai World Trade Centre alongside The Big 5 – the only live in-person event gathering the global construction industry this year.

Across 15 categories, and inspired by the United Nations’ Sustainable Development Goals, The Big 5 Impact Awards is a platform to celebrate the achievements and transformation of the construction industry that go beyond traditional measures of project delivery.

Awards for sustainable development make up one-third of the categories at The Big 5 Construction Impact Awards, finalists for the standout “Sustainable Initiative of the Year” include: Dubai Municipality, Dubai Authorities, Emaar Jordan GBC Skidmore, Owings & Merrill (SOM) The Arab Contractors Company Turner & Townsend Finalists have been assessed against individual category criteria by an independent and international judging panel.
